πŸ” Regional Insight: Essequibo Islands-West Demerara

Essequibo Islands-West Demerara encompasses the islands at the Essequibo River mouth and the west bank of the Demerara River. Major agricultural hub for rice and sugarcane production. Regional seat is Vreed en Hoop.

Towns & Villages in this Region

West Coast Demerara: Vreed-en-Hoop, Windsor Forest, La Jalousie, Den Amstel, Hague, Leonora, Stewartville, Uitvlugt, Zeeburg, Met-en-Meerzorg, De Willem, Tuschen, Zeelugt, Vergenoegen, Parika. West Bank Demerara: Goed Fortuin, Schoonord, La Grange, Nismes, Bagotville, Canal No. 1, Canal No. 2, Stanleytown, Wales, Patentia, Vriesland, Vive-la-Force. Wakenaam Island: Sans Souci, Maria's Pleasure, Good Success, Melville. Leguan Island: Enterprise, Blenheim, Maryville, La Bagatelle, Waterloo.
